For development of this site at Trump International Golf Links & Hotel, Doonbeg, Kilrush, Co. Clare, V15 KH39. The development will consist of: a) The construction of new golf tee boxes serving Holes 3 and 17, including associated turfing, edging, contouring and grading works to integrate the golf tee boxes into the existing golf course layout and design; b) The demolition and removal of a section of the existing internal access road, and the realignment and construction of a new and upgraded internal access road, including all associated works and services; c) Landscaping and remodelling of adjoining improved grassland areas, including minor contouring, low earth mounding to improve visual screening, integration of the new golf tee boxes and associated walkways, the formation of a pond and associated wetland areas, and the expansion and enhancement of the existing improved grassland; and, d) All associated site development works, including earthworks, temporary fencing, reseeding, landscaping, ground reinstatement and any ancillary works required to facilitate the development. A Natura Impact Statement (NIS) has been prepared for this development and is submitted with this planning application
